Villanova Hosts Lafayette Thursday for Doubleheader

April 13, 2016

Villanova, Pa. - The Villanova softball team (19-13, 6-3 BIG EAST) will look to improve upon their ten-game winning streak Thursday as they host the Lafayette Leopards for a doubleheader.

Game one will start at 3:00 p.m. with game two to follow at 5:00 p.m. All home games are played at the Villanova Softball Complex.

Villanova is currently riding a ten-game winning streak after sweeping Seton Hall last week and beating Penn 12-0 (F5) last Tuesday afternoon.

Junior Chase Snell was named to the BIG EAST Weekly Honor Roll this week for her performance last week.

For the week, Snell was 5-for-7 (.714) with two RBI's, and four runs scored. In BIG EAST play, Snell batted .833. while her slugging percentage was at .714. The native of Poway, Calif. is hitting .379 on the year, and she is second on the team in hits with 36.

Senior pitcher Kate Poppe (13-9) went 3-0 this past weekend as Villanova took three games from conference foe Seton Hall. Her first was a 10-3 win over the Pirates last Sunday in which she recorded her 900th career strikeout. Poppe ranks second in the NCAA Division I in active career strikeouts with 910. Her second win was a 9-5 win over Seton Hall in game two Sunday. Poppe finished off the Pirates this past Monday with a 2-1 win in nine innings.

Sophomore shortstop Brittany Husk was 6-for-9 with five RBI's, and four runs scored last week. Husk, who hails from Miami, Fla., is tied for first on the team in doubles with nine. She is hitting .330 on the year.

Senior Shea Palmer returned from injury last week going 4-for-7 at the plate with two RBI, two runs scored, and one walk. The Scottsdale, Ariz. native is hitting .297 on the year in 64 at-bats.

Overall, the 'Cats have seven players who are .300 or better this season. As a team, Villanova is hitting which is good for 38th in the country.

Scouting the Leopards

Lafayette enters play Thursday at 10-22 overall and 2-7 in Patriot League play having taken two out of three games from conference foe Holy Cross this past weekend.

Brooke Wensel and Samantha Sweigart leads Lafayette offensively as both are hitting .333 this season. Wensel has accounted for team-high 33 hits this season. She is also tied for the team lead in RBI's with 15.

On the pitching side, Kristyn Marinelli is 3-6 on the year with a 4.32 ERA in 60.0 innings pitched. She has struck out 26 batters.

Villanova is 13-4 since 1999 vs. the Leopards. The Wildcats split a doubleheader last year in Easton against Lafayette.
